0

如果我将视图控制器推到 NavController 上,在设计此视图时有没有办法让控件正确排列?

这是我遇到的问题,我必须像这样对齐 TableView 和 MapView 才能让它在加载到导航控制器时正确显示:

在此处输入图像描述

这似乎是错误的。如您所见,mapview 与编辑器中的 tableview 重叠,但是当它运行时它们正确排列。如果我将 mapview 提升到直接在 tableview 的顶部排列,则在运行时,两者之间会出现白色间隙。我意识到 NavBar 正在推动事情,或者这是我的猜测。

我可以设置实用程序中的任何内容来处理此问题吗?

4

2 回答 2

0

您可以手动告诉视图控制器在属性检查器的界面构建器中显示导航栏。

在此处输入图像描述

于 2012-12-21T04:22:16.330 回答
0

选择您的视图,然后在 File Inspector 中,取消选中Use Autolayout。它可能会帮助你。

于 2012-12-21T04:42:02.220 回答